About Jio Chak Village

Jio Chak is a small village in Dasua tehsil, in the district of Hoshiarpur, Punjab.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 192, made up of 91 males and 101 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,110 females per 1000 males. The village covers 81 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 144205,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Jio Chak

The census records public bus service for Jio Chak as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
